Manufacturing Documentation Engineer

CoWorx Staffing Services is seeking a Manufacturing Documentation Engineer in the Chelmsford, MA area. We are seeking a detail-oriented Manufacturing Documentation Engineer to support manufacturing operations through the creation, maintenance, and control of Bills of Materials (BOMs), Engineering Change Orders (ECOs), and manufacturing documentation.

This role is responsible for ensuring that product structures, documentation packages, and manufacturing records are accurate, complete, and aligned with engineering, procurement, quality, and production requirements. The position supports SMT/PCBA, cable and harness assemblies, box build, and electro-mechanical manufacturing environments and plays a critical role in product configuration management and new product introductions.
